Parkinson's disease (PD) is a neurodegenerative disorder characterized by both motor and non-motor symptoms. These may include bradykinesia, tremor, rigidity, postural instability, autonomic dysfunction, sensory and sleep difficulties, neuropsychiatric problems, etc. Research indicates a strong association of genetic and environmental factors to the development of PD. The diagnosis of PD is usually based on presenting symptoms. Neuroimaging is usually done to rule out other diseases.
